ACICLOVIR EG 5% cream
Generic medicine
What it is and what it is used for
ACICLOVIR EG is a cream for topical application that contains the active ingredient acyclovir, belonging to a group of medicines used against viral infections (antivirals).
ACICLOVIR EG is used for the treatment of infections caused by the Herpes simplex virus, both on the lips (cold sores) and on the genitals (primary or recurrent genital herpes).
Consult your doctor if you do not feel better or if you feel worse after a few days.
What you need to know before taking the medicine
Do not use ACICLOVIR EG
- if you are allergic to acyclovir, valacyclovir, propylene glycol, or any of the other ingredients of this medicine (listed in section 6).
Warnings and precautions
Talk to your doctor or pharmacist before using ACICLOVIR EG.
ACICLOVIR EG should not be applied to the eyes, or to the internal mucous membranes of the mouth or vagina, as it could cause irritation.
Consult your doctor and use this medicine with caution if you have a weakened immune system, as you are more susceptible to infections (for example, if you have AIDS or have had a bone marrow transplant). In this case, oral acyclovir may be necessary.
Avoid long-term treatment, as it can cause an allergic reaction (sensitization). If this happens, stop treatment immediately and contact your doctor.
Possible side effects
Like all medicines, this medicine can cause side effects, although not everybody gets them.
The following side effects may occur:
Uncommon (may affect up to 1 in 100 people):
- transient burning or pain;
- moderate dryness and flaking of the skin;
- itching.
Rare (may affect up to 1 in 1000 people):
- skin redness (erythema);
- inflammatory skin reaction (contact dermatitis), mainly due to the components of the cream base.
Very rare (may affect up to 1 in 10,000 people):
- allergic reactions manifesting as swelling of the face, lips, mouth, tongue or throat, which may cause difficulty in swallowing and breathing (angioedema), hives.
